Use "profusion" in a sentence | "profusion" example sentences

How to use "profusion" in a sentence?

  • A profusion of fancies and quotations is out of place in a love-letter. True feeling is always direct, and never deviates into by-ways to cull flowers of rhetoric.
    -Christian Nestell Bovee-
  • Without troublesome work, no one can have any concrete, full idea of what pure mathematical research is like or of the profusion of insights that can be obtained from it.
    -Edmund Husserl-
  • Nature would not appear so rich, the profusion so rich, if we knew a use for everything.
    -Henry David Thoreau-
  • Profusion gives pleasure up to a point; then we become squeamish.
    -Mason Cooley-
  • This profusion of eccentricities, this dream in masonry and living rock is not a drop scene in a theatre, but a city in the world of reality.
    -Robert Louis Stevenson-
  • Whitecaps in profusion all around me, but somehow in your eyes I found the strength to sail upon that raging sea.
    -Gordon Lightfoot-
  • Devotion means a profusion of life.
    -Jaggi Vasudev-
  • The materials for poetry are all about you in profusion.
    -Masaoka Shiki-

Definition and meaning of PROFUSION

What does "profusion mean?"

/prəˈfyo͞oZHən/

noun
Property of being great in number; abundance.

What are synonyms of "profusion"?
Some common synonyms of "profusion" are:
  • abundance,
  • lot,
  • mass,
  • host,
  • plenitude,
  • cornucopia,
  • riot,
  • plethora,
  • superfluity,
  • superabundance,
  • glut,
  • surplus,
  • surfeit,
  • quantities,
  • scores,
